Definition of the Print Advertising Distribution in Maine?

This industry directly distributes and delivers advertisements (e.g. circulars, coupons and handbills) and samples. Operators deliver advertisements or samples door-to-door, place flyers and coupons on car windshields in parking lots and hand out samples in retail stores. This industry does not include establishments that distribute advertising materials or samples through the mail.

What is the market size of the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ine in 2025?

The market size of the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ine is $683.1k in 2025.

How many businesses are there in the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ine in 2025?

There are 2 businesses in the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ine, which has been declining at an average annual rate of 0.0% from 2020 to 2025.

Has the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ine grown or declined over the past 5 years?

The market size of the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ine has been declining at an average annual rate of -6.2% from 2020 to 2025.

How many employees in the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ine in 2025?

There are 5 employees in the Print Advertising Distribution industry in Maine, which has been declining at an average annual rate of -3.6% from 2020 to 2025.
